Postcode Overview

of B31 3PB

B31 3PB is a residential postcode located on Redhill Road, Northfield, Birmingham, B31. It is the 381st largest postcode in the B31 area.

It contains 10 houses and 4 unknown and the most common type of property is a mid-century house built between 1936 and 1979.

Average property prices

in B31 3PB

The average house value is £201,031. Sales values have increased in the last 12 months by 5.8% and Rental values have increased by 4.5%.

Property sale values range from £192,557 for a freehold house, with 3 bedrooms split across 861 square feet of gross internal area and has a garden to £224,091 for a freehold house, with 4 bedrooms split across 1,119 square feet of gross internal area and has a garden.

Average £/ft2 for properties in B31 3PB is £213/ft2.

Properties achieve a rental yield of between 6.2% and 6.7%, and rental values range from £1,073 to £1,155 per month.

Recent sales

within B31 3PB

The last sale was 08 Oct 2021 for £161,000 and since then the market in the area has increased by 16.6%. The postcode has had a total of 4 sales since 1995.

B31 3PB has seen 3 sales in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
